ARTIFACT:
Rare 1930's US Air Corps Flight Surgeon ID bracelet from Captain Pfaff of the 113th Observation Squadron Indiana National Guard. The 113th performed a number of important state duties such as aerial mapping, air coverage during labor strikes, and flood relief during the Wabash River Flood.
